ORCGeNext 2.0

Licencji: Bezpłatna wersja próbna ‎Rozmiar pliku: 475.86 KB
‎Ocena użytkowników: 3.0/5 - ‎1 ‎Głosów

O ORCGeNext

Cele To narzędzie może służyć do generowania kodu podstawowego (atrybuty, warstwa dostępu do danych, warstwa logiki biznesowej, warstwa prezentacji, projekt uruchamiania, serwer aplikacji, klient think) dla aplikacji wielowarstwowych, które współpracują z bazami danych. Aplikacja generowana przez to narzędzie można uruchomić i pracować z bazą danych bez dodatkowych zmian w jego kodzie. -To wspaniałe narzędzie generuje w pełni funkcjonalne aplikacje bazy danych MDI WinForm; -To świetne narzędzie zmniejsza ręcznie tworzony kod; -To świetne narzędzie generuje w pełni interfejs użytkownika WinForm (generowanie kontroli interfejsu użytkownika, powiązanie danych dla kontroli interfejsu użytkownika i obiektu biznesowego, generowanie kodu sprawdzania poprawności itp.); -To świetne narzędzie generuje oddzielny kod dla warstwy logiki interfejsu użytkownika i biznesowej (zwiększenie łatwości konserwacji); -To świetne narzędzie sprawia, że wolne od ręcznie tworzone zapytanie SQL, ale można to zrobić (jeśli jest to konieczne); -To wielkie toll generetaes kod, który rozszerzalność, aby pomieścić logikę biznesową. Bieżąca wersja tego narzędzia obsługuje program MS SQL Server 2000 Bieżąca wersja tego narzędzia obsługuje c# 2003 (WinForm) Bieżąca wersja tego narzędzia obsługuje c# 2005 (WinForm) Ogranicza bazy danych Każda tabela bazy danych musi mieć klucz podstawowy. Klucz podstawowy musi mieć tylko jedno pole. Kod podstawowy Kod podstawowy zawiera pięć oddzielnych projektów. Każdy projekt jest warstwą w architekturze wielowarstwowej. Każdy projekt zawiera klasy. Każda klasa ma według tabeli w bazie danych. Fizycznie każda klasa dzieli się na dwie klasy, klasę podstawową i klasę niestandardową. Klasa podstawowa zawiera kilka metod podstawowych (CRUD - tworzenie, odczytywanie, aktualizowanie, usuwanie dla każdej tabeli) i/lub pola, które współpracują z bazą danych. Klasy podstawowe są generowane automatycznie i ręczna edycja klas podstawowych nie jest zalecane. Klasy niestandardowe po prostu dziedziczą klasy podstawowe i są używane do realizacji logiki biznesowej aplikacji. Kod podstawowy został wygenerowany za pomocą szablonów.